The iconic CN Tower, a symbol of Toronto's skyline, is undergoing significant renovations to improve visitor experience and maintain its structural integrity. These enhancements aim to solidify the tower's position as a world-class tourist attraction for years to come.

Current Renovation Projects

Observation Deck Upgrade

The main observation deck is being revamped with state-of-the-art viewing technology. New floor-to-ceiling windows will offer unobstructed panoramic views of Toronto's evolving cityscape.

Elevator Modernization

High-speed elevators are being upgraded to enhance speed and comfort. The new system will reduce wait times and provide a smoother ascent to the tower's various levels.

Planned Future Enhancements

  • Interactive Digital Exhibits

    A series of cutting-edge digital installations will be introduced, offering visitors immersive experiences about the tower's history and Toronto's development.

  • Revolving Restaurant Refurbishment

    The 360 Restaurant will undergo a modern makeover, featuring an updated menu and enhanced rotating mechanism for a smoother dining experience.

  • Exterior Lighting Upgrade

    A new LED lighting system will be installed, allowing for more dynamic and energy-efficient light shows that will illuminate Toronto's night sky.

Structural Maintenance

In addition to visitor experience improvements, critical structural maintenance is being carried out to ensure the CN Tower's longevity:

Concrete Rehabilitation

Experts are conducting thorough inspections and repairs of the tower's concrete structure to address any wear and tear from decades of exposure to Canadian weather.

Antenna Maintenance

The communications and broadcast equipment at the tower's pinnacle are being upgraded to keep pace with evolving technology and maintain clear signals.
